+.macro tr4_luma_shift r0, r1, r2, r3, shift
+        saddl       v0.4s, \r0, \r2         // c0 = src0 + src2
+        saddl       v1.4s, \r2, \r3         // c1 = src2 + src3
+        ssubl       v2.4s, \r0, \r3         // c2 = src0 - src3
+        smull       v3.4s, \r1, v21.4h      // c3 = 74 * src1
+
+        saddl       v7.4s, \r0, \r3         // src0 + src3
+        ssubw       v7.4s, v7.4s, \r2       // src0 - src2 + src3
+        mul         v7.4s, v7.4s, v18.4s    // dst2 = 74 * (src0 - src2 + src3)
+
+        mul         v5.4s, v0.4s, v19.4s    // 29 * c0
+        mul         v6.4s, v1.4s, v20.4s    // 55 * c1
+        add         v5.4s, v5.4s, v6.4s     // 29 * c0 + 55 * c1
+        add         v5.4s, v5.4s, v3.4s     // dst0 = 29 * c0 + 55 * c1 + c3
+
+        mul         v1.4s, v1.4s, v19.4s    // 29 * c1
+        mul         v6.4s, v2.4s, v20.4s    // 55 * c2
+        sub         v6.4s, v6.4s, v1.4s     // 55 * c2 - 29 * c1
+        add         v6.4s, v6.4s, v3.4s     // dst1 = 55 * c2 - 29 * c1 + c3
+
+        mul         v0.4s, v0.4s, v20.4s    // 55 * c0
+        mul         v2.4s, v2.4s, v19.4s    // 29 * c2
+        add         v0.4s, v0.4s, v2.4s     // 55 * c0 + 29 * c2
+        sub         v0.4s, v0.4s, v3.4s     // dst3 = 55 * c0 + 29 * c2 - c3
+
+        sqrshrn     \r0, v5.4s, \shift
+        sqrshrn     \r1, v6.4s, \shift
+        sqrshrn     \r2, v7.4s, \shift
+        sqrshrn     \r3, v0.4s, \shift
+.endm
+
+function ff_hevc_transform_luma_4x4_neon_8, export=1
+        ld1            {v28.4h-v31.4h}, [x0]
+        movi           v18.4s, #74
+        movi           v19.4s, #29
+        movi           v20.4s, #55
+        movi           v21.4h, #74
+
+        tr4_luma_shift v28.4h, v29.4h, v30.4h, v31.4h, #7
+        transpose_4x4H v28, v29, v30, v31, v22, v23, v24, v25
+
+        tr4_luma_shift v28.4h, v29.4h, v30.4h, v31.4h, #12
+        transpose_4x4H v28, v29, v30, v31, v22, v23, v24, v25
+
+        st1            {v28.4h-v31.4h}, [x0]
+        ret
+endfunc
